[#1214] *: Use single Object
type in whole project
Remove `Object` and `RawObject` types from `pkg/core/object` package. Use `Object` type from NeoFS SDK Go library everywhere. Avoid using the deprecated elements. Signed-off-by: Leonard Lyubich <leonard@nspcc.ru>
